    I think that compared with Japanese cultural export, Chinese cultural export is inferior in its choice of export carrier, Japanese cultural export focuses on popular culture as the carrier, while Chinese cultural export format is relatively simple.

    1. Why has Japanese culture been able to spread so quickly to other countries?

    When it comes to Japan, there is nothing we are most familiar with in manga, games, and clothing. Take manga as an example, and to this day manga is still the main export point of Japanese culture, Japan knows what children like, and what they do is capture the psychology of the masses. Recently, the popular new "King's Ranking" has attracted the attention of a large number of Chinese children.

    Why is anime popular? Because the story is good, and in these cartoons, we gradually become familiar with a series of traditional Japanese cultures such as kimono and ninjutsu. Japan uses pop as a vehicle to promote their traditional culture, and this kind of propaganda is easy for others to accept.

    Let's talk about the Japanese costumes that have been very popular recently, everyone in the JK circle is no stranger, and JK clothing has also penetrated into other countries through Japanese movies and TV series. If you just post some ** alone, it is difficult to arouse the interest of others. And adding these costume elements to movies, TV and comics will make people look good and try it.

    2. The shortcomings of China's cultural export

    China is a great country, with countless 5,000 years of cultural essence. Many people mistakenly believe that China's cultural export to foreign countries is to promote our traditional culture, and the essence of the nation cannot be denied, but the cultural products that can really go out need to ensure that they are good-looking, fun, and can cater to the public psychology, otherwise others will find it boring. Cultural products need to meet the people's requirements for spiritual entertainment, and can only be promoted to foreign countries if they become popular in their own countries.

    If a Wu Wu cultural products are not widely welcomed in the country. So how does he gain a foothold in the world? Nowadays, many people in China focus on the promotion of traditional culture (Peking Opera Troupe, Confucius Wencha Tangerine Dialectic, literati ancient things, etc.), these traditional cultures are contrary to the entertainment of modern human beings, as leisure time hobbies can be, but as the main output is not.

    I think that when Japan exports the culture of their bad country, they spread their culture in a form of entertainment, whether it is a geisha performance on the street, or a Noh theater troupe organized by the Japanese side, they are all in a very casual and entertaining way to arouse the interest of the world, people, and people from all countries in Japanese culture, in contrast, when China exports Chinese culture, it adopts a very formal way, which is a very official way, so it is difficult to arouse the interest of other people.     There is a certain gap between China and Japan in terms of cultural output, and when it comes to Japan, we can think of cultural symbols such as anime, samurai, sashimi, sushi, etcOn the contrary, our China does not have a strong sense of form in cultural export, does not rely on the propaganda of the old traditional culture enough, and the cultural carrier has not yet been clarified.

    1. Cultural exportCultural export refers to the process by which a country, in order to achieve a certain goal, consciously disseminates or imposes its traditional values and ideas on other countries. To a certain extent, cultural output is the establishment of a country's ideology and national image, the most important of which is the content of culture, the content of cultural output determines the quality of the national image, and its essence is to convey a comprehensive and real social image. At present, China's cultural export is mainly based on a long history, and in recent years, the country has highlighted creative output, with cultural creativity as the main body, and adhered to the combination of take-it-or-leave-it and cultural export, so as to enhance the stamina of development.

    2. The difference between China and Japan's cultural exportWhen it comes to a major cultural exporting country, the first thing that comes to our mind is Japan. Japan's cultural output covers anime, samurai, sashimi, sushi, games, tokusatsu films, and more. These carriers are disseminated to the outside world through elements of popular culture.

    The Japanese are particularly good at studying the spiritual entertainment needs of their own people, cultural products.

    After the development of maturity in China, it began to export a large number of products to Asia, Europe and the United States. Since the youth of all countries are broadly similar, they are the same in terms of receiving things. One of the key to Japan's success in exporting culture is its ability to meet the needs of people.

    3. The uncertainty of the carrierFrom the perspective of cultural output such as China, the biggest problem at present lies in the uncertainty of the carrier. At present, we are exporting some ancient civilizations, such as Tang costumes, Confucian and Mencian culture, Chinese food, pandas, etc. To some extent, China has established traditional literature as the essence of Chinese culture.

    But at present, there are not too many subjects to give it publicity. In the early days, we could promote it through film and television works, books, etc., but with the development of the Internet in recent years, if we want to pass on the core values of Chinese culture, we should also return to traditional Chinese culture. At present, the most important thing for the export of Chinese culture is to find the right carrier and actively work on this carrier.
